FVCB Hedge Fund Activity: Q2 2022 in Review
58 of the 5,936 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in FVCBankcorp (FVCB) for Q2 2022, worth a combined $97.7M — up 5.7% from $92.4M a quarter earlier.
Buyers outnumbered sellers: 20 funds opened new FVCB positions and 14 closed out — a net gain of 6 holders — while 21 added to existing stakes and 9 trimmed.
The largest buyer was BlackRock, adding an estimated $9.83M. The largest seller was EJF Capital, exiting entirely with an estimated $3.63M sold.
